Jacobs Joint Venture Named Amtrak's Delivery Partner for Frederick Douglass Tunnel Program

Supports modernization for America's busiest passenger railroad, improving service and travel times for millions

DALLAS, April 8, 2024 /PRNewswire/ -- Jacobs (NYSE:J), operating under a joint venture with AECOM, was selected as Amtrak's Delivery Partner for the Frederick Douglass Tunnel program, one of the largest national transportation infrastructure investments. The joint venture team will provide program and construction management services from contract initiation through service commissioning.

The Frederick Douglass Tunnel program, with an estimated construction value at $6 billion, according to Amtrak, includes two new high-capacity tunnel tubes designed for electrified passenger trains. In addition, new roadway, railroad bridges and upgraded rail systems, together with improved accessibility thanks to a new ADA-accessible West Baltimore MARC station, will transform a ten-mile section of the Northeast Corridor and deliver significant improvements to local infrastructure.

"These enhancements will improve reliability, speed and safety through a critical link in the Northeast Corridor driving economic growth and fostering community development," said Jacobs Senior Vice President Chrissy Thom. "As Amtrak's first Delivery Partner with an innovative program management delivery model, the team can address challenges quickly and transparently without disrupting service on one of Amtrak's busiest routes."

Currently in the demolition phase, major construction activities for this transformative program will begin later this year.
